AVACHAR

Verified contract

Active on Ethereum with 1,098 txns
Deployed by via 0xf6bdd27d at 16676285
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
3 additional variables

No balances found for "AVACHAR"

0xd7c76a50dc4d464a707923afe606d926915d591f6ac1fd3367dbce4d1d8f2b5e
0x57087d78502217a6588ca8a53efb8e7535cba9c4e9711b45b5efd0ce821249fa
0xcd2862a5e9197c454a73331b7e8f4f2623c1b98c9665d0a9c0af8d9e3bd5f3a8
0xfa82272cbe14effe8670c949dcf0b09e40378f7c9ef57be922e0dff0f0cbc1e7
0xc385fdef80702362d1604fd7293555676bd63f88d033297fd51913a19cae4df4
0x81dc2a746c7313ab4118c1bcefbe7377bbe8ec201ba27b20b0c91e6c13b8d41b
0x38355b9b5c0a4f9b5afe8e1851e91f9faf6b4259398df937c9991f945aca872c
0xc7238dd0151310356d774e9a03a1aca430d5b40f8545ca3c6b58f51523bed8e0
0x3bd9bda3abee021349e50e3a60520fd00da825650bbf85865af89445a47b0953
0x16a67132ba51c78ebc5840a0bf2377aac9c665430213871895590158e2285730

Functions
Getter at block 20823165
CONTRACT_VERSION(view returns (uint8)
2
MAX_WALLET_MINTS(view returns (uint256)
3
PRICE(view returns (uint256)
0
_baseTokenExtension(view returns (string)
.json
_baseTokenURI(view returns (string)
ipfs://bafybeif72ih54pohq4m7ljkaig6tt34iitkhb3bh7ikyzqmkmfrsivfxai/
baseTokenURI(view returns (string)
ipfs://bafybeif72ih54pohq4m7ljkaig6tt34iitkhb3bh7ikyzqmkmfrsivfxai/
collectionSize(view returns (uint256)
3000
contractURI(pure returns (string)
https://metadata.mintplex.xyz/PqoLMD9nOzGHNtRLvl7R/contract-metadata
currentTokenId(view returns (uint256)
3000
enforcePublicDropTime(view returns (bool)
true
erc20Payable(view returns (address)
0x43e26b18331226751b708a76d0b6c9afefea2c3f
getNextTokenId(view returns (uint256)
3001
maxBatchSize(view returns (uint256)
3
mintingOpen(view returns (bool)
true
name(view returns (string)
AVACHAR
nextOwnerToExplicitlySet(view returns (uint256)
0
onlyERC20MintingMode(view returns (bool)
false
owner(view returns (address)
0x43e26b18331226751b708a76d0b6c9afefea2c3f
payableAddressCount(view returns (uint256)
1
publicDropTime(view returns (uint256)
1676991600
publicDropTimePassed(view returns (bool)
true
strictPricing(view returns (bool)
true
symbol(view returns (string)
AVACHAR
totalSupply(view returns (uint256)
3000
Read-only
balanceOf(address ownerview returns (uint256)
canMintAmount(address _addressuint256 _amountview returns (bool)
chargeAmountForERC20(address _erc20TokenContractview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
getPrice(uint256 _countview returns (uint256)
inTeam(address _addressview returns (bool)
isApprovedForAll(address owneraddress operatorview returns (bool)
isApprovedForERC20Payments(address _erc20TokenContractview returns (bool)
ownerOf(uint256 tokenIdview returns (address)
payableAddresses(uint256view returns (address)
payableFees(uint256view returns (uint256)
restrictedApprovalAddresses(addressview returns (bool)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enByIndex(uint256 indexview returns (uint256)
tokenOfOwnerByIndex(address owneruint256 indexview returns (uint256)
tokenURI(uint256 tokenIdview returns (string)
State-modifying
addOrUpdateERC20ContractAsPayment(address _erc20TokenContractbool _isActiveuint256 _chargeAmountInTokens
addToTeam(address _address
approve(address touint256 tokenId
disableERC20ContractAsPayment(address _erc20TokenContract
disableERC20OnlyMinting(
disablePublicDropTime(
enableERC20ContractAsPayment(address _erc20TokenContract
enableERC20OnlyMinting(
mintToAdminV2(address _touint256 _qty
mintToMultiple(address _touint256 _amountpayable 
mintToMultipleERC20(address _touint256 _amountaddress _erc20TokenContractpayable 
openMinting(
removeFromTeam(address _address
renounceOwnership(
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es _data
setApprovalForAll(address operatorbool approved
setApprovalRestriction(address _addressbool _isRestricted
setBaseTokenExtension(string baseExtension
setBaseURI(string baseURI
setERC20PayableAddress(address _newErc20Payable
setMaxMint(uint256 _newMaxMint
setPrice(uint256 _feeInWei
setPublicDropTime(uint256 _newDropTime
setStrictPricing(bool _newStatus
setWalletMax(uint256 _newWalletMax
stopMinting(
transferFrom(address fromaddress touint256 tokenId
transferOwnership(address newOwner
usePublicDropTime(
withdrawAll(
withdrawERC20(address _tokenContractuint256 _amountToWithdraw
Events
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
Constructor
constructor(
Fallback and receive

This contract contains no fallback and receive objects.

Errors
CannotBeNullAddress(
CapExceeded(
DropTimeNotInFuture(
DuplicateTeamAddress(
ERC20InsufficientAllowance(
ERC20InsufficientBalance(
ERC20TokenNotApproved(
ERC20TransferFailed(
ERC721RestrictedApprovalAddressRestricted(
ExcessiveOwnedMints(
InvalidPayment(
InvalidTeamAddress(
MintZeroQuantity(
NoStateChange(
OnlyERC20MintingEnabled(
OperatorNotAllowed(address operator
PublicDropTimeHasNotPassed(
PublicMintClosed(
TransactionCapExceeded(
ValueCannotBeZero(